    Relevancy rankings : pay for performance search engines in the hot seat by Goh, Dion Hoe-Lian, Ang, Rebecca P.

    Published 2009
    “…A study was conducted to compare the retrieval effectiveness of Overture (a PFP search engine) and Google (a traditional search engine) using a test suite of general knowledge questions. Forty-five queries based on a popular game show “Who Wants to be a Millionaire” were submitted to each of these search engines and the first 10 documents returned were analyzed using different relevancy criteria. …”

    Egg development, hatching, and larval development of Marble Goby Oxyeleotris marmoratus under artificial rearing conditions by Senoo, Shigeharu, Kaneko, Masaharu, Cheah, Sin Hock, Ang, Kok Jee

    Published 1994
    “…All embryonic heads were located at the basal part of the egg and this was taken as normal egg development for O. marmoratus. In spite of their well-developed eyes and mouths, and the fact that they exhibited the active S-posture, the larvae did not feed on artificial powdered feed or Brachionus spp. for 4--6 days (d) AF, and the mortality before the feeding of Brachionus spp. was much higher than that of the later stages. …”
